Question

Prove that, the points (1,5),(2,3), and (-2,-11) are not collinear.

Open in App
Solution

Let the points are A(1,5),B(2,3) and C(2,11) respectively i.e. co-ordinate of A is (1,5), co-ordinate of B is ( 2, 3) and co-ordinate of C is (-2, -11).
AB=(21)2+(35)2=12+(2)2=1+4=5BC=(22)2+(113)2=16+196=212CA=(1(2))2+(5(11))2=9+256=265
It is clear that sum of distances of any two sides is not equal to third side. So these points are not collinear.
